#156ab0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#156ab0 is composed of 8.2% red, 41.6%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.1% cyan, 39.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 207.1 degrees, a saturation of 78.7% and a lightness of 38.6%. #156ab0 color hex could be obtained by blending #2ad4ff with #000061.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#156ab0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#156ab0 has RGB values of R:21, G:106, B:176 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.4, Y:0,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 1403568.
